The India Meteorological Department has forecast widespread rain and thunderstorms across every district of Arunachal Pradesh beginning on September 15, urging residents to stay prepared.

The India Meteorological Department (IMD) released a weather outlook indicating that rain showers and thunderstorms will affect all districts of Arunachal Pradesh from September 15 onward. The advisory covers the state's diverse terrain, from the low‑lying plains of Papum Pare to the high‑altitude areas of Tawang and Upper Subansiri.

Meteorologists expect intermittent downpours accompanied by strong gusts and occasional lightning, especially during the late afternoon and evening hours. While the system is not projected to bring extreme flooding, localized waterlogging and reduced visibility on mountain roads are possible.

Authorities in the state have been advised to monitor river levels and keep emergency response teams on standby. Residents are urged to secure loose objects, avoid travel on vulnerable routes, and stay updated through local news and official IMD bulletins.

The forecast aligns with the region's typical monsoon pattern, which intensifies in September. Farmers in the valley districts are advised to protect standing crops, and schools in high‑risk zones may consider temporary closures if conditions deteriorate.
